引导和文档
整体上,文档和引导做得还行,能让人一步步跟着操作。不过有些地方感觉有点简略,特别是事件驱动机制那块,如果你对MNS不熟,可能要花点时间自己摸索。整体来说,还算顺利。部署和代码
提供的代码示例挺实用的,基本上可以直接用来参考。我遇到的最大问题是内存配置不足,导致函数计算超时。调整内存后问题就解决了,算是个小插曲。- 使用体验
性能:函数计算的性能让我挺满意,特别是它在高并发下还能稳稳地处理任务,感觉比自己直接在服务器上搞要省心得多。
稳定性:把文件处理从核心应用里剥离出来后,主应用的稳定性明显提升,毕竟文件处理挂了也不会拖累整个系统。
成本:成本控制得不错,按量付费这个模式挺划算的,不像以前那样要为高峰期预留一堆资源,平时又用不上,浪费钱。 - 云产品的体验
函数计算:用了之后感觉挺方便,配置简单,支持的语言也多,扩展能力很强,完全能满足实际需求。
对象存储 OSS:这个就不用多说了吧,存储方案一如既往地稳定,跟函数计算配合得挺顺畅。
消息服务 MNS:MNS在这个方案里还是挺关键的,虽然配置的时候权限要注意点,但用起来效果不错。
云服务器 ECS 和 RDS MySQL:这些传统的云产品表现中规中矩,没啥惊喜,但也没拖后腿,算是稳扎稳打的基础设施。
总结
总的来说,这套方案让我对函数计算的弹性和成本控制能力印象深刻。虽然过程中有点小问题,但整体体验还是挺顺利的。如果你们公司也有类似的多媒体处理需求,强烈建议试试这个方案,特别是当你需要应对高并发或是不确定流量的时候,能帮你省不少事儿。